State prepares to deliver the 14th Usina da Paz in Pará, in Capanema
The complex will be a reference for serving more than 70,000 residents of the city, with over 70 services and assistance available

The residents of Capanema, in northeastern Pará, are eagerly awaiting the delivery of the first Usina da Paz (UsiPaz) in the municipality and throughout the Caeté region. The 14th unit of Brazil's largest citizenship project will be inaugurated next Saturday (14), providing the population with a complete structure of free services in the areas of education, culture, sports, social assistance, health, professional training, and citizenship.
The new complex will be a reference for serving more than 70,000 residents of the city, offering over 70 integrated services and assistance to strengthen social inclusion and promote quality of life.

Complete structure - Located in the Jardim América Residential area, the UsiPaz in Capanema will feature a spacious and modern structure, equipped with rooms for medical and dental care, document issuance, vocational courses, social assistance, as well as sports and cultural spaces, such as a multipurpose gym, swimming pool, open court, and multicultural square.
“The delivery of the Usina da Paz in Capanema represents more than a completed project. It represents the commitment of the Government of Pará to inclusion, dignity, and social transformation. We are very happy to see this structure ready to serve the people of Capanema and the region,” emphasized the State Secretary of Citizenship Articulation, Elieth Braga.

The Capanema unit joins the other 13 Usinas da Paz already in operation in the neighborhoods of Jurunas/Condor, Guamá, Terra Firme, Bengui, and Cabanagem in Belém; Ananindeua, Marituba, Benevides, and Castanhal in the Metropolitan Region; Abaetetuba in Baixo Tocantins; and Marabá, Parauapebas, and Canaã dos Carajás in southeastern Pará.
Only in 2025, the Government of Pará has already inaugurated the units in Benevides, Castanhal, Marabá, and Abaetetuba, directly benefiting more than 684,000 people in the four cities.

More Usinas - Another 23 new UsiPaz are under construction in the cities of Altamira, Bragança, Cametá, Paragominas, Tucuruí, Santa Izabel do Pará, Redenção, Itaituba, Santarém, Viseu, Igarapé-Miri, Barcarena, Breves, Dom Eliseu, São Miguel do Guamá, Portel, Moju, Parauapebas (second Usina), Óbidos, Salinópolis, Tomé-Açu, São Félix do Xingu, and Belém, in the Icoaraci district.
